Panic on the Tarmac: Air Canada Flight's Disturbing Incident

Understanding the Incident

On December 13, 2025, Air Canada Flight 1502, which was preparing to depart from Toronto Pearson Airport to Moncton, was suddenly derailed by a horrifying series of events. Moments before takeoff, muffled screams and banging sounds emerged from the aircraft's cargo hold, leaving the 184 passengers shaken and bewildered.

A ground crew member had inadvertently become trapped in the cargo hold when the doors closed during preparations. The Voices of the Passengers

Passengers reported hearing distressing sounds of muffled screams and banging just as the flight began to taxi towards the runway. Gabrielle Caron, one passenger, described how the flight attendants rushed down the aisle, visibly alarmed. “Some of the people sitting towards the back of the plane heard the person screaming and banging, trying to get their attention,” Caron recalled. Ground Crew Safety Protocols

The revelation that a crew member had been left unaccounted for during critical preparation phases begs the question: how robust are the existing safety measures during ground operations? According to local news reports from CBC, the trapped employee had been assisting ground staff by loading items and may not have been counted after the doors closed. The Immediate Aftermath

After the alarming episode, the flight was canceled, and passengers were safely returned to the terminal. The incident, which fortunately left everyone unharmed, took a serious toll on those aboard, many of whom reported feeling fear and confusion. The absence of injuries is a relief, but it does not diminish the gravity of the situation. Air Canada confirmed to CBC that no passengers or crew members suffered any physical harm, but the emotional and psychological impacts should not be overlooked.
